SEPTIC TANK LOCATION
BONE OF CONTENTION AGAIN
BOROUGH-COUNCIL DECISION
The much discussed matter of septic tanks was again before the New Plymouth Borough Council last night. At its previous meeting the council had declined to endorse a recommendation by two of the three members of the works committee that the tanks must be nt least 25 feet from the boundary of the section and the proposed condition was rejected. Last night, Cr. McPhillips moved, on behalf of the works committee, that the condition be reimposed. The Mayor: I don’t think you can move the rc-impositiou of a condition that the council has already thrown out. Cr. McPhillips; Well, I will move as an amendment that the distance be 24 feet. Cr. S. G. Smith: I move as a further amendment that the 4 of the 24 be struck out. / surprised councillor: Two feet! Cr. Smith: The one is as ridiculous as the otner. Cr, P. E. Stainton considered that Cr. McPhillips really wanted the council to decide upon some definite distance in lieu of the 25 feet the council had rejected. He accordingly, moved that the distance be 17 feet. Cr. H. V. S. Griffiths said he thought it made little difference how near the septic tank was to the boundary. The g that mattered was the location of the outlet of the effluent. He accordingly moved that the tanks be placed not less than five feet from the boundary, and the outlets of the effluent be not less than 15 feet from the boundary Cr. Smith moved that the whole discussion be ruled out of order, on the grounds that it .was contrary to the by-laws for councillors to attempt to ! ,am :d cr alter a resolution once passed - by the council without notice of motion, j The Mayor ruled, however, that the j amendments suggested by Crs, Stainton I and Griffiths were in t! a form of additions to the regulations, and were in I order. Cr. Griffiths’ amendment was put ami ' lost, and Cr. Stainton’s amendment was ! carried.
